It’s that time of the year again. Time to identify and acknowledge the latest Android app development trends for the next year.
Today, we live in an era where each new year brings new innovations, ideas, and trends that signify changes. And since Android adoption has grown so drastically in the past recent years, it’s important to keep up with the latest trends to knock out competitors in the race of acquiring market share.
Before we jump right into it, though, it’s also important to understand the implications of trends, which is why it’s recommended to partner with an Android app development company to rightly capitalize on the benefits.
That being said, let’s dive right in!
5 Android App Development Trends to Follow in 2020
1 – Continued Rise of Android Instant Apps
Android Instant Apps basically allows users to try an application or game before having to install it on their devices.
As you can see, Android Instant apps make it possible to completely skip the installation process and remove the clutter of having to install unnecessary apps on Android devices.
In simple words, Android Instant Apps are nothing but simple to use mobile websites that are operated directly from the cloud.
While 2019 already saw a significant rise of Android Instant Apps, next year it will keep growing further with more innovations.
2 – Android Jetpack
Android Jetpack is Google’s latest Android application development suite of tools, libraries, and guidance that will help developers build higher-quality Android apps.
The Jetpack suite was designed to help developers cope up with important issues like backward compatibility, application management, and so on.
Google has basically smartly structured all these things in a suite with four simple categories: UI, architecture, behavior, and foundation.
The Jetpack’s components, on the other hand, are unbundled libraries that are not part of the Android platform, meaning you can easily adapt any component depending on your requirements.
3 – Kotlin
Kotlin, as you might already know, is a new programming language that runs on Java Virtual Machine (JVM).
To put it simply, Kotlin is capable of utilizing all the existing tools of Android Studio!
In other words, not only building apps with Kotlin is easy, but converting the existing Java-based Android app to Kotlin is also easy.
The nullability and immutability features in Kotlin allows creating high-performance and quality Android apps.
The best features of Kotlin are its interoperability, compatibility, fast compilation time, and performance. In fact, these are the features that make Kotlin one of the best frameworks for Android app development.
4 – Android Enterprise
After iOS, Android devices are the most used devices in corporate enterprises for work.
Keeping this in mind, Google created Android Enterprise, a program that establishes the best Android app development practices specifically for the Enterprise ecosystem.
This new Google-led program basically provides complete control over the Android enterprise apps and the data owned by the enterprise organization.
Apart from this, Android Enterprise also offers various APIs and tools that let Android app developers integrate the support for Android in Enterprise mobility management.
5 – AI & Machine Learning
Artificial Intelligence (AI) has already shown its potential in the world of Android app development. As you might already know, the technology is powerful enough to make unimaginable changes.
For instance, a normal machine can do specific tasks repetitively without any issue, but if you program them intelligently using AI & Machine Learning, you can also make the machine do tasks that are out of the league.
In simple words, you can collect, feed, and process a huge amount of data using AI & ML in your app development process and perform tasks like Face recognition, text recognition, landmark recognition, image labeling, barcode scanning, and so on.
There are many tools available for Android app development to build such functionalities in your Android app.
Bonus: Multiplatform Application Development with Flutter
Created by Google, Flutter is a mobile app development framework that allows developers to build native Android and iOS applications from a single codebase.
Though Flutter had been around for a couple of years, but it gained most attention after Google announced a release preview of Flutter at Google I/O 2018.
Then on 4th December 2018 at Flutter Live, Google released the first stable version with lots of features and many big brands like Alibaba soon adopted it to build mobile apps.
There you have it!
These are the top Android app development trends you need to keep in mind for 2020. As you just saw, there will be a major shift in the Android app industry in the year 2020.
We hope that this blog will help you in developing an Android app stand out in the market and outrun your competition. If you have any questions, feel free to ask in the comment section below.
General FAQs on Android Application Development Trends:
Q:1 – What technology is used to develop mobile apps?
Ans: There are many technologies available in the market such as Swift, Flutter, Phonegap, React Native, and a lot of others.
Q:2 – What software is used for Android application development?
Ans: Android application development process requires various things such as a programming language, an IDE, tools, libraries and so on.
Q:3 – Can I build my own app for Android?
Ans: Yes, you can build your own Android app using online tools like AppyPie.
Q:4 – How can I make a free app without coding?
Ans: There are many online tools available in which coding is not required to build mobile apps. For example, you can use AppMakr, Swiftic, Appy Pie, and other available tools.